实验3LF低频ATA5577卡实验V2017.doc

实验3LF低频ATA5577卡实验V2017.doc

ID:57275842

大小:2.66 MB

页数:8页

时间:2020-08-08

实验3LF低频ATA5577卡实验V2017.doc_第1页
实验3LF低频ATA5577卡实验V2017.doc_第2页
实验3LF低频ATA5577卡实验V2017.doc_第3页
实验3LF低频ATA5577卡实验V2017.doc_第4页
实验3LF低频ATA5577卡实验V2017.doc_第5页
资源描述:

《实验3LF低频ATA5577卡实验V2017.doc》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、实验3LF低频ATA5577卡实验-V1.实验目的了解AT5577卡应答芯片内部存储结构;掌握EM4095阅读器程序设计;掌握本平台模块的操作过程;2.实验设备硬件:4号低频节点,公母直连串口线,低频ATA5577卡(表面一般无印刷字)等;软件:Keil,串口调试助手等;STC_ISP路径:配套光盘第三方应用软件STC_ISP;串口调试工具路径:配套光盘第三方应用软件串口调试及CRC软件串口调试工具;源码地址:配套光盘源代码RFID基础实验实验3LF低频ATA5577卡实验-V;Hex路径:配套光盘源代码RF

2、ID基础实验实验3LF低频ATA5577卡实验-Vout3.实验原理3.1ATA5577简介ATA5577是Atmel生产的非接触、无源、可读/写、具有防碰撞能力的RFID应答芯片,中心工作频率为125kHz。兼容T5557、ATA5567、E5551、T5551等应答芯片。兼容ISO/IEC11784/11785标准。3.2ATA5577存储器结构ATA5577的操作主要是对内部存储器EEPROM进行操作。ATA5577的配置数据也存放在EEPROM中。EEPROM结构如图3.1所示:标蓝的数据位只能写入,不能传送图3.1

3、EEPROM结构存储器EEPROM由11块(block)构成,组成2页(page)。第0页包含8块,第1页包含3块。每块有33位(bit),即ATA5577的EEPROM一共有363位。第1页的块0就是第0页的配置数据。在每块的第0位是锁存位(lockbit)。除去锁存位,第0页的块0是芯片的配置数据共32位;第0页的块1到块7是用户数据共7×32位(当需要密码保护时,块7作为密码数据);第1页的块0是第0页的配置数据共32位;第1页的块1到块2是UID/可追溯数据共64位;第1页的块3是AFE选项寄存器数据共32位。锁存位是块

4、写保护位。初始默认为0,块可读可写。写入1后块只可读不可写。注意锁存位是一次性写入位,一旦写入,永不可再解锁,块也永不可写入数据。3.3ATA5577配置在3.2中我们已经讲到EEPROM的第0页第0块是芯片的配置数据,其结构如下图2所示。主要配置芯片的数据速率、最大块、解调方式、操作模式等。这里主要讲解最大块和操作模式配置,其他配置请参考芯片数据手册。图3.2配置数据第25、26、27是最大块(MaxBlock)配置,其数值为页读时读取的最大块数。第23、28分别是AOR(Answer-On-Request)和PWD(Pass

5、word)位,用于配置芯片操作模式。ATA5577有三种操作模式,见下表1:PWDAOR在Reset/POR后工作模式11AOR模式•需要用匹配的密码唤醒后才启动调制•用于防碰撞•编程需要有效的密码10密码模式•Reset后调制启动•编程和直接访问需要有效的密码01正常模式•Reset后调制启动•编程和直接访问不需密码表1ATTA5577操作模式其它配置位按默认设置,详细请参考芯片数据手册。3.4低频接口指令协议接口指令协议见下表命令格式成功返回值失败返回读page0FFFF0128BYTE+MAXBLKFF读page1FFFF

6、028BYTEFF写page0FFFF03BLOCK4BYTE*BLOCK00FF密码页写FFFF04BLOCK4BYTE*BLOCK4PASS00FF常规读块FFFF05BLOCK4BYTEFF常规写块FFFF06LOCKBLOCK4BYTE00FF密码读块FFFF07BLOCK4PASS4BYTEFF密码写块FFFF08LOCKBLOCK4BYTE4PASS00FF卡初始化FFFF094PASS00FF读ID卡FFFF0A5BYTEFF写ID卡FFFF0B5BYTE00FF蜂鸣器响(不用)FFFF0CT-delay设波特率F

7、FFF0DBAUD00FF关闭串口FFFF0E00,置P0.5=0联机检测(不用)FFFF0F00,置P0.5=1FF写配置字FFFF10LOCKUPWMAXBLKAOR4PASS00FF唤醒卡(不用)FFFF114PASS00FF表2协议指令说明:头2个字节FFFF是命令头,第3个是命令字BLOCK块号,范围1-7MAXBLK最大块,常规页写范围1-7,密码页写范围1-6LOCK锁定位,0不锁定,1锁定AOR唤醒0正常,1需要唤醒UPW加密设定,0不加密,1加密,设定密码时块7内容为密码BYTE数据XBYTE为X个字节数据PA

8、SS密码4个字节BAUD波特率代码0=4800,1=9600,2=14400,3=19200,4=28800,5=38400,6=57600T-delay蜂鸣器响时间,取值0-255P0.5单片机引脚19,此为预留功能3.5低频程序设计STC单片机控制EM409

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。